Why there are no depth contours on any of our sheets

A contour is a line drawn between two soundings by somebody who was not there. On a bar, that line is the difference between a passage and a grounding.

Somebody asked last week why our sheets look unfinished. It is a fair question. Open any chart on the shelf and the water is banded — a five-metre line, a ten, a twenty, tints between them, the shape of the bottom laid out at a glance. Ours have figures and one line, and the one line is the coast.

That is deliberate, and it is the only strong opinion this company holds about drawing.

What a survey actually produces

A survey boat runs lines. It measures a depth, at a position, at a moment, and it reduces that depth to chart datum using the tide it observed at the time. What comes back is a scatter of points: a few hundred of them on a small sheet, a few million on a modern one.

That is the measurement. Everything else on a chart is drawing.

A depth contour is produced afterwards, on land, by somebody deciding where the five-metre line runs between the soundings. On even ground that decision is nearly free. Over a bank that shifted last winter, on run lines fifty-eight metres apart, it is a guess — and it is a guess that comes out looking exactly as authoritative as the soundings it was interpolated from. Same ink, same weight, same sheet.

The soundings are data. The contour is an opinion about the ground between them, drawn in the same ink as the data. That is the whole of the objection.

Skellow Bar is why we care

Run the line spacing over Skellow Bar and the problem is not abstract. The bar is a shoal that runs across the approach, and its crest is narrow. A contour drawn between two soundings either side of the crest will pass straight over the top of it, and the sheet will then show clear water where the least depth is. That is not a defect in the cartographer. It is what interpolation does to a feature narrower than the sample interval.

The figures cannot lie in that particular way. If there is no sounding on the crest, the sheet shows no sounding on the crest, and the gap is visible as a gap. You can see where nobody went. That is worth more than a smooth picture.

What we draw instead

One stroke, and every depth as a figure

Each plate carries exactly one stroked path — the coastline, which is observed rather than interpolated — and puts every measured depth on the sheet as a numeral. Plain figures are metres below chart datum. Underlined figures are drying heights: ground that stands above chart datum and uncovers. There is no tint, no fill, and no contour on any sheet in the set.

Across the seven sheets that is 1,531 soundings and zero contours, and both of those numbers are counted out of the shipped files rather than claimed. You can count them yourself; the figures are text in the SVG.

The honest caveat

Our seven sheets are not survey records. They come out of a modelled seabed written for this purpose, and the survey page says so at the top rather than in a footnote. The argument above is about how a sheet should be drawn, not a claim that we have been out there with a boat.

If you are working real ground, work it off the official survey. If you are looking at ours, look at the gaps.
